After fighting in the First and Second World Wars on behalf of the United Kingdom, First Nations peoples returned home motivated to improve their status and living conditions in Canada. In 1945, the government abolished the pass system, which for 60 years had restricted status Indians to reserves. They could leave only with a pass issued by an Indian Agent. WebThe Hawthorn Report, officially known as A Survey of the Contemporary Indians of Canada: a Report on Economic, Political, Educational Needs and Policies: in Two Volumes, was released in 1966 and 1967. The report is notable for coining a number of phrases that were later embraced by First Nations leadership.
